Say No to Maida with Jowar-made Tasty and Healthy Cutlets

Hence, with the aim to satisfy your cravings towards fried snacks without compromising your good health, we have come up with tasty and healthy Jowar-made snacks i.e. Jowar-made potato cutlets and Jowar-made paneer cutlets.

Jowar Potato smashed Cutlet

Jowar Paneer-made Cutlet with Cucumber
Ingredients Required:-

·         2 cups of Jowar in powered form
·         Half cup of hot water
·         Boiled potatoes
·         Smashed paneers
·         Cumin seeds
·         Grated carrots and capsicum (you may add any veggie of your own choice)
·         Turmeric powder
·         Ginger-garlic paste
·         Cumin powder
·         Coriander powder
·         Chilli powder
·         Amchur powder
·         Garam masala
·         Oil and
·         Salt to taste



Preparation of the Stuffing:-
·         Smash the boiled potatoes/ paneer properly
·         Heat the oil in a pan
·         Add cumin seeds
·         Add grated veggies and boiled potatoes/smashed paneer
·         Add ginger-garlic paste
·         Add turmeric powder, chilli powder, cumin powder and coriander powder
·         Add salt as per taste, amchur powder and garam masala
·         Stir occasionally to cook the stuffing
·         Remove the stuffing from pan and leave it cool




Preparation of Dough and Small Balls:-

·         Take the powered form of Jowar in a bowl
·         Add a pinch of salt and black salt
·         Mix the powered jowar with the stuffing in a well manner
·         Add water occasionally to prepare the dough
·         Make circular/elliptical shapes from the dough
·         Heat the oil in the pan and
·         Deep-fry both sides until it turns golden brown (alternatively, you may opt to shallow fry)
·         Serve hot with sauce or chutney of your own choice.
